Dematic Corporation is now hiring for a Regional Field Service
Technician. Under the direction of the Field Service Manager, this
position provides service and repair as well as service and
maintenance training for installed Dematic systems and equipment.
As the Dematic representative in the Customer's facility, this
position has a heavy responsibility for maintaining customer
goodwill toward Dematic. Primary objective is to ensure that
Dematic systems have the greatest availability possible for
Customer use and to ensure that Customers are satisfied with their
Dematic system and equipment. This role can be based anywhere
throughout North America, preferably by nearby airport for
travel.
Qualifications:
- Trade school graduate or two year Associates degree in a
mechanical, electrical, or mechanical technician program. Bachelors
degree in Engineering preferred.
- Two years (minimum) experience in troubleshooting
electromechanical and/or mechanical equipment. Successful candidate
must have some working experience with material handling equipment.
Service experience with
- AGVS, AS/RS, or conveyors is highly prized.
- Must be willing to travel on short notice and spend more than
80% of the time traveling. May be continuously away from home for
as long as a month (offer travel expenses).
- Must be willing to be availible during off hours and travel
accordingly.
- Willingness to work weekends, holidays and off shifts.
- Must be able to act calmly in stressful situations.
- Must be able to write concise, clear, and complete trip reports
in the time frame required according to Dematic procedures.
- Must have knowledge in the use of personal computers for word
processing, data base functions and communications. Understanding
personal computer hardware setup and software configuration
required.
- Working experience with troubleshooting PLC's is required.
